Default Help needed - a list of gigging musicians

Hi. I need help from the AGF members

I'm creating a website that will list the tour dates (or upcoming gigs) for acoustic guitar players of all levels. Now, there are obvious additions (like Tommy E, Phil Keaggy, etc, etc). But I need a BIG list of musicians (of all levels) who play live shows that I can add. The musicians can gig only in one city or all over the world. They can be local musicians who will never be big time, or they can be Grammy winners.

My purpose? I often travel to various cities. I get there, I check various websites (citysearch, etc) and newspapers to find a good show I can go see. I often find that info is hard to narrow down. Then I find out I missed Pete Huttlinger at a small club because it wasn't listed there. Oh, rest assured someone like Britney Spears would be listed, but not a solo acoustic guitarist playing a small club. (I just use this as an example - not an actual scenario.) And there are some amazing guitarists out there that I would love to see - if I knew when to catch them. This will put a whole lot of acoustic musician's shows on one site, so it should be easier to indeed know when they are coming.

My site will include as many quality acoustic players as possible, and will include all of their upcoming shows (with links where applicable). Plus, the site will be searchable by Artist, state, city and date. So you should have no trouble finding out if someone will be performing near you the weekend you will be in "town X".

What I would like from forum members are names. Names of musicians you've heard of, or musicians you know - any gigging acoustic musician qualifies (including yourself, obviously). So you can reply to this with suggestions. Or you can e-mail me (my e-mail address is in my profile) with names. Once a good list is developed I will start researching their shows and hopefully have some version of it running soon after that.

I think this will be a nice site, that will be a benefit to both the artists as well as folks looking for a show. So, if the fine folks here at the AGF don't mind - please give me some names to include.

The only real rules are:
1) They must actually play live (even one day a month is fine with me - let's get them listed)

2) They must do (at least around 85% of the time or more) solo acoustic music (duo type stuff is fine, too). Fingerstyle, flatpicking, strumming and singing, pop, country, folk, Christian - doesn't really matter. Let's get them listed so folks will see them.


That's pretty much it. Let me know what you think. I'm open to suggestions as this is a work in progress. How can I make the site more useful?

Thank y'all very much in advance! This will be a fun project.
